Hydrothermal Geothermal Energy Market to Reach USD 18.25 Billion by 2032, Growing at 5.91% CAGR Globally

The hydrothermal geothermal energy market is projected to reach USD 18.25 billion by 2032, growing at a CAGR of 5.91%. This growth is driven by rising global demand for renewable energy, favorable government policies, and technological advancements in geothermal exploration and drilling. Key trends include hybrid geothermal systems, enhanced digital monitoring, and increasing investments in deep-well technology.
Published 07 July 2025

The hydrothermal geothermal energy market is on a steady upward trajectory, set to grow from USD 11.53 billion in 2024 to USD 18.25 billion by 2032. This represents a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 5.91% over the forecast period. The surge is largely attributed to the increasing global emphasis on renewable energy adoption, decarbonization efforts, and improved technologies that make geothermal energy more accessible, reliable, and economically viable.

Market Drivers

1. Growing Demand for Renewable and Low-Carbon Energy Sources:

Governments and energy agencies worldwide are investing heavily in clean energy to meet climate targets and reduce dependence on fossil fuels. Hydrothermal geothermal energy, being a consistent and eco-friendly source, plays a critical role in the global energy transition.

2. Supportive Government Policies and Incentives:

Incentives such as tax credits, grants, and feed-in tariffs are encouraging the development of geothermal projects. Policies aimed at carbon neutrality and net-zero emissions further boost the hydrothermal geothermal energy market by making investments in this sector more attractive and less risky.

3. Base Load Capability and Reliability:

Unlike solar or wind energy, geothermal systems provide consistent, round-the-clock electricity. This base load capability makes hydrothermal geothermal energy particularly valuable in regions with fluctuating renewable generation.

4. Technological Advances in Drilling and Resource Identification:

Enhanced geothermal systems (EGS), advanced 3D reservoir modeling, and improved drilling techniques are lowering the costs and increasing the success rates of hydrothermal geothermal projects, making them more competitive with other energy sources.

Key Market Trends

1. Hybrid Geothermal Systems Gaining Momentum:

Integrating geothermal energy with solar and biomass is becoming a popular approach to increase energy output and stability. Hybrid systems allow for better resource optimization and are especially useful in areas with diverse energy demands and mixed renewable goals.

2. Increasing Use of Digital Monitoring and AI:

Digital technologies such as AI, IoT, and machine learning are being integrated into geothermal systems for real-time monitoring, predictive maintenance, and performance optimization. These tools help reduce downtime, operational costs, and environmental impact.

3. Deep-Well Drilling and Enhanced Resource Utilization:

Exploration into deeper geothermal wells is unlocking previously inaccessible hydrothermal reservoirs. High-temperature wells located deeper underground are now economically feasible thanks to robust drilling technologies and high-temperature equipment.

4. Industrial and Direct Use Applications Rising:

In addition to electricity generation, hydrothermal energy is being used in heating, aquaculture, greenhouse farming, and district heating systems. This diversification of use cases is expanding the market scope and attracting new stakeholders.

Regional Analysis

North America:

North America is one of the leading regions in hydrothermal geothermal energy, with the United States being a global pioneer. The region benefits from favorable geology, advanced infrastructure, and strong government support for renewable energy projects. Emerging developments in Nevada, California, and Oregon continue to shape the U.S. market landscape.

Europe:

Europe is aggressively pushing toward carbon neutrality, making geothermal energy an essential part of its renewable mix. Countries like Iceland, Italy, Germany, and Turkey are investing heavily in hydrothermal projects for both electricity and heating. The EU’s Green Deal and funding frameworks further accelerate adoption.

Asia Pacific:

APAC is witnessing significant growth due to high energy demand, favorable volcanic landscapes, and strong policy support. Indonesia and the Philippines lead the regional market, with Japan, China, and India increasing exploration and investments to diversify their energy portfolios.

Latin America:

Countries such as Mexico, Chile, and Costa Rica are leveraging their geothermal potential to reduce reliance on fossil fuels. Government-led initiatives and international collaborations are creating a conducive environment for project development and foreign investment.

Middle East and Africa:

Geothermal potential in East African countries like Kenya and Ethiopia is being tapped through international funding and regional cooperation. The Middle East is exploring geothermal to support off-grid applications and sustainable development goals, particularly in the UAE and Saudi Arabia.

Challenges and Constraints

1. High Initial Capital Investment:

Although operating costs are low, the upfront cost for exploration, drilling, and plant setup remains a major challenge. Securing financing is particularly difficult for projects in developing countries or regions with high geological uncertainty.

2. Resource Location Limitations:

Hydrothermal geothermal systems are geographically limited to areas with natural heat, water, and permeability. This restricts large-scale development in non-volcanic or geologically inactive regions.

3. Environmental and Seismic Concerns:

Although clean, geothermal energy development can sometimes lead to land subsidence, water contamination, or induced seismicity. These concerns require careful assessment, regulatory compliance, and community engagement.

4. Lengthy Project Timelines and Permitting Issues:

The time required for site identification, environmental assessments, permitting, and drilling can delay projects significantly. Complex regulatory frameworks in some regions add further delays and increase the cost burden.

Market Opportunities

1. Expansion of District Heating Networks:

Geothermal heat is increasingly being used in residential and commercial heating networks. This application is gaining traction in cold-climate countries looking to reduce heating-related emissions and costs.

2. Technological Innovation and EGS Development:

Enhanced geothermal systems allow energy extraction from dry, impermeable rock using artificial stimulation. This innovation opens up new geographic markets and increases the total exploitable geothermal resource base.

3. Decentralized Energy Systems and Microgrids:

Hydrothermal energy is well-suited for off-grid and decentralized power systems, especially in rural or remote regions. Mini-geothermal plants can power communities, mining operations, and industrial zones with minimal environmental impact.

4. Investment from Public and Private Sectors:

Global sustainability funds, green bonds, and ESG-focused investors are pouring capital into clean energy projects. Partnerships between governments, international banks, and private enterprises offer a strong foundation for hydrothermal geothermal market growth.
